Output 808ff66699a8d1a6e0052c18955cbb91196107a94e2c9d401d09327cb95e8d14:2

value
51396687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6144b97dffd49d6645bfdb259f38febe9d1ace1 OP_EQUAL
address
3NfZeohVEDsKgT7m3yx9bqVZSsrApkYb7T
transaction
808ff66699a8d1a6e0052c18955cbb91196107a94e2c9d401d09327cb95e8d14
spent
true